Overview of the Roborock S7 Maxv Ultra 2026

The Roborock S7 Maxv Ultra 2026 is the latest iteration of Roborock’s flagship robotic vacuum. It boasts cutting-edge features such as advanced mapping, powerful suction, and seamless smart home connectivity. Designed for modern households, it aims to be more than just a vacuum—it’s marketed as a comprehensive smart home hub.

Key Features

  • Advanced Navigation: Uses LiDAR technology for precise mapping and obstacle avoidance.
  • Powerful Suction: Equipped with a 5100Pa suction motor for deep cleaning.
  • Automatic Dirt Disposal: Features a self-emptying dock that handles debris for weeks.
  • Smart Home Integration: Compatible with Alexa, Google Assistant, and Apple HomeKit.
  • Custom Cleaning Zones: Allows users to designate specific areas for targeted cleaning.
  • App Control: Fully controllable via the Roborock app with scheduling and monitoring features.

Is It the Smart Home Hub You Need?

The idea of a robot vacuum doubling as a smart home hub is appealing. The S7 Maxv Ultra 2026 offers extensive smart device compatibility, enabling users to control smart lights, thermostats, and security cameras through its interface. However, its primary function remains cleaning, and its hub capabilities are supplementary.

Pros as a Smart Home Hub

  • Centralized control of multiple smart devices.
  • Integration with popular voice assistants.
  • Easy automation setup through the app.

Limitations

  • Limited compatibility with some smart home ecosystems.
  • Primarily designed for cleaning, not as a dedicated smart hub.
  • Requires continuous internet connection for full functionality.

While the S7 Maxv Ultra 2026 enhances smart home integration, it may not replace a dedicated smart home hub like Samsung SmartThings or Amazon Echo. It functions best as a cleaning robot with some smart control features rather than a full-fledged smart home control center.
